0001009022-15-000010.txt : 20150731 0001009022-15-000010.hdr.sgml : 20150731 20150731121132 ACCESSION NUMBER: 0001009022-15-000010 CONFORMED SUBMISSION TYPE: 13F-HR/A PUBLIC DOCUMENT COUNT: 2 CONFORMED PERIOD OF REPORT: 20150630 FILED AS OF DATE: 20150731 DATE AS OF CHANGE: 20150731 EFFECTIVENESS DATE: 20150731 FILER: COMPANY DATA: COMPANY CONFORMED NAME: INVESTMENT MANAGEMENT OF VIRGINIA LLC CENTRAL INDEX KEY: 0001009022 IRS NUMBER: 541994290 STATE OF INCORPORATION: VA FISCAL YEAR END: 1231 FILING VALUES: FORM TYPE: 13F-HR/A SEC ACT: 1934 Act SEC FILE NUMBER: 028-05332 FILM NUMBER: 151018592 BUSINESS ADDRESS: STREET 1: P.O. BOX 1156 CITY: RICHMOND STATE: VA ZIP: 23218-1156 BUSINESS PHONE: (804) 643-1100 MAIL ADDRESS: STREET 1: PO BOX 1156 CITY: RICHMOND STATE: VA ZIP: 23218-1156 FORMER COMPANY: FORMER CONFORMED NAME: SSCM LLC /VA DATE OF NAME CHANGE: 20000713 FORMER COMPANY: FORMER CONFORMED NAME: SCOTT & STRINGFELLOW CAPITAL MANAGEMENT INC/VA DATE OF NAME CHANGE: 19990329 13F-HR/A 1 primary_doc.xml 13F-HR/A LIVE false false false 0001009022 XXXXXXXX 06-30-2015 06-30-2015 true 1 RESTATEMENT INVESTMENT MANAGEMENT OF VIRGINIA LLC
PO BOX 1156 RICHMOND VA 23218-1156
13F HOLDINGS REPORT 028-05332 N
George J. McVey, Jr. Chief Compliance Officer (804) 643-1100 George J. McVey, Jr. Richmond VA 07-31-2015 0 182 433840 false
INFORMATION TABLE 2 imva.xml 3D Systems Corp. COM 88554d205 25168 1289310 SH SOLE 1251758 0 37552 3M Co. COM 88579Y101 2796 18123 SH SOLE 13076 0 5047 AT&T Inc. COM 00206R102 2507 70569 SH SOLE 58594 0 11975 AT&T Inc. COM 00206R102 14 396 SH OTR 396 0 0 AbbVie Inc. COM 00287Y109 5941 88415 SH SOLE 74680 0 13735 Abbott Labs. COM 002824100 5089 103683 SH SOLE 84618 0 19065 Advanced Energy Inds. COM 007973100 5856 213020 SH SOLE 200475 0 12545 Albemarle Corporation COM 012653101 638 11550 SH SOLE 11550 0 0 Allergan, Inc. SHS G0177J108 253 834 SH OTR 834 0 0 Altisource Asset Management Co COM 02153X108 3361 23296 SH SOLE 21696 0 1600 Altisource Ptfl Solns Reg Shs COM L0175J104 5514 179084 SH SOLE 171294 0 7790 Altria Group Inc. COM 02209S103 929 18992 SH SOLE 17592 0 1400 American Express Co. COM 025816109 4449 57248 SH SOLE 52025 0 5223 American Express Co. COM 025816109 54 700 SH OTR 700 0 0 American Public Ed Inc COM 02913V103 1735 67460 SH SOLE 65970 0 1490 Anacor Pharmaceuticals Inc. COM 032420101 9104 117575 SH SOLE 107910 0 9665 Anadarko Petroleum COM 032511107 3025 38758 SH SOLE 35722 0 3036 Analog Devices Inc. COM 032654105 1253 19515 SH SOLE 19515 0 0 Anthem Inc COM 036752103 333 2026 SH SOLE 1236 0 790 Apple Inc. COM 037833100 211 1685 SH SOLE 1685 0 0 ArcBest Corporation COM 03937C105 1171 36825 SH SOLE 36035 0 790 Argan Inc. COM 04010E109 718 17815 SH SOLE 17390 0 425 Automatic Data Processing COM 053015103 2228 27770 SH SOLE 20305 0 7465 Avid Technology, Inc. COM 05367P100 1795 134525 SH SOLE 131535 0 2990 BB&T Corp. COM 054937107 3677 91209 SH SOLE 82967 0 8242 BB&T Corp. COM 054937107 89 2200 SH OTR 2200 0 0 BWX Technologies Inc. COM 05605H100 8422 358846 SH SOLE 337258 0 21588 Babcock & Wilcox Enterprises, COM 05614L100 3366 180000 SH SOLE 169208 0 10792 Baxter International COM 071813109 1239 17720 SH SOLE 16610 0 1110 Becton, Dickinson & Co. COM 075887109 2946 20797 SH SOLE 15385 0 5412 Berkshire Hathaway "B" CL B NEW 084670702 1191 8747 SH SOLE 6660 0 2087 Blackrock Inc. COM 09247X101 1555 4495 SH SOLE 4495 0 0 Blackrock Inc. COM 09247X101 61 175 SH OTR 175 0 0 Bottomline Technologies, Inc. COM 101388106 4060 146005 SH SOLE 137526 0 8479 Briggs & Stratton Corporation COM 109043109 3168 164487 SH SOLE 156677 0 7810 Bristol Myers Squibb Co. COM 110122108 449 6751 SH SOLE 6351 0 400 Bristol Myers Squibb Co. COM 110122108 94 1420 SH OTR 1420 0 0 Broadridge Financial Solutions COM 11133T103 987 19742 SH SOLE 19742 0 0 Broadridge Financial Solutions COM 11133T103 39 775 SH OTR 775 0 0 CSX Corporation COM 126408103 414 12670 SH SOLE 9670 0 3000 Cameron Intl COM 13342B105 5151 98351 SH SOLE 93593 0 4758 Cameron Intl COM 13342B105 42 800 SH OTR 800 0 0 Capital One Finl Corp. COM 14040h105 1321 15015 SH SOLE 12915 0 2100 Caterpillar, Inc. COM 149123101 2036 24001 SH SOLE 16850 0 7151 Chevron Corp. COM 166764100 3765 39031 SH SOLE 28068 0 10963 Chevron Corp. COM 166764100 29 300 SH OTR 300 0 0 Chicos Fas Inc COM 168615102 10614 638227 SH SOLE 606717 0 31510 Cisco Systems COM 17275r102 4751 173022 SH SOLE 152082 0 20940 Coca-Cola Company COM 191216100 2694 68665 SH SOLE 50028 0 18637 Consolidated Edison Co Of N.Y. COM 209115104 805 13902 SH SOLE 10327 0 3575 Corning, Inc. COM 219350105 1332 67500 SH SOLE 63025 0 4475 Costco Whsl Corp. New COM 22160k105 914 6765 SH SOLE 5038 0 1727 Credit Suisse Asst Mgm Com COM 224916106 56 17440 SH SOLE 17440 0 0 Cree, Inc. COM 225447101 4077 156611 SH SOLE 143842 0 12769 Crocs Incorporated COM 227046109 3912 265950 SH SOLE 262340 0 3610 Cummins Inc. COM 231021106 1460 11127 SH SOLE 11127 0 0 Cummins Inc. COM 231021106 23 175 SH OTR 175 0 0 Cyberonics Inc. COM 23251P102 1129 18995 SH SOLE 18615 0 380 Danaher Corp. COM 235851102 2854 33343 SH SOLE 24168 0 9175 Dominion Resources, Inc. VA Ne COM 25746u109 2587 38692 SH SOLE 29142 0 9550 Dow Chemical COM 260543103 244 4766 SH SOLE 4766 0 0 Du Pont E I De Nemours & Co. COM 263534109 3890 60830 SH SOLE 47788 0 13042 Du Pont E I De Nemours & Co. COM 263534109 64 1000 SH OTR 1000 0 0 Duke Energy Corp. COM 26441C204 1689 23920 SH SOLE 19999 0 3921 Duke Energy Corp. COM 26441C204 28 400 SH OTR 400 0 0 EMC Corp. COM 268648102 1449 54900 SH SOLE 54900 0 0 EMC Corp. COM 268648102 47 1775 SH OTR 1775 0 0 EOG Resources Inc. COM 26875P101 306 3500 SH SOLE 1500 0 2000 EPIQ Systems Inc. COM 26882D109 2836 167984 SH SOLE 159639 0 8345 EPIQ Systems Inc. COM 26882D109 25 1500 SH OTR 1500 0 0 Emerson Elec Co COM 291011104 2837 51182 SH SOLE 44464 0 6718 Emerson Elec Co COM 291011104 44 800 SH OTR 800 0 0 Express Scripts Hldg. Co. COM 30219G108 1695 19057 SH SOLE 18863 0 194 Exxon Mobil Corp. COM 30231g102 4813 57852 SH SOLE 39895 0 17957 Exxon Mobil Corp. COM 30231g102 25 300 SH OTR 300 0 0 Fastenal Co. COM 311900104 2393 56735 SH SOLE 54835 0 1900 Firstmerit Corp. COM 337915102 3688 177076 SH SOLE 169141 0 7935 Fluor Corp. COM 343412102 1427 26925 SH SOLE 25250 0 1675 General Electric Co. COM 369604103 5940 223574 SH SOLE 187689 0 35885 General Electric Co. COM 369604103 56 2100 SH OTR 2100 0 0 Gentex Corp. COM 371901109 1399 85181 SH SOLE 80555 0 4626 Green Dot Corp CL A 39304D102 2463 128823 SH SOLE 126053 0 2770 Halliburton Company COM 406216101 1101 25555 SH SOLE 23355 0 2200 Home Depot, Inc. COM 437076102 1094 9845 SH SOLE 7352 0 2493 Horizon Global Corporation COM 44052W104 284 18860 SH SOLE 18446 0 414 Iberiabank Corp. COM 450828108 2577 37770 SH SOLE 36204 0 1566 Intel Corporation COM 458140100 4518 148532 SH SOLE 116477 0 32055 International Business Machs. COM 459200101 6551 40273 SH SOLE 33722 0 6551 International Business Machs. COM 459200101 128 785 SH OTR 785 0 0 Intersil Corporation CL A 46069S109 4730 378072 SH SOLE 364001 0 14071 Intrepid Potash Inc. COM 46121Y102 8229 689162 SH SOLE 641822 0 47340 Invesco Ltd. SHS G491BT108 1516 40425 SH SOLE 40425 0 0 J. P. Morgan Chase COM 46625h100 2994 44182 SH SOLE 32470 0 11712 Johnson & Johnson COM 478160104 3998 41020 SH SOLE 30948 0 10072 Johnson Ctls Inc. COM 478366107 2266 45748 SH SOLE 45474 0 274 Johnson Ctls Inc. COM 478366107 40 800 SH OTR 800 0 0 Juniper Networks, Inc. COM 48203R104 1598 61545 SH SOLE 61545 0 0 KVH Inds Inc Com COM 482738101 11546 858437 SH SOLE 810831 0 47606 Kinder Morgan, Inc. COM 49456b101 2133 55554 SH SOLE 49633 0 5921 Kraft Foods Group Inc. COM 50076Q106 2162 25389 SH SOLE 22383 0 3006 Kraft Foods Group Inc. COM 50076Q106 28 333 SH OTR 333 0 0 Kroger Co. COM 501044101 1279 17635 SH SOLE 17635 0 0 Kroger Co. COM 501044101 87 1200 SH OTR 1200 0 0 Lennar Corp. CL A 526057104 1537 30105 SH SOLE 30105 0 0 Lowes Cos Inc COM 548661107 1474 22015 SH SOLE 19015 0 3000 Lowes Cos Inc COM 548661107 67 1000 SH OTR 1000 0 0 Luminex Corp. COM 55027e102 22101 1280477 SH SOLE 1215185 0 65292 MDC Holdings Inc. COM 552676108 8141 271642 SH SOLE 257282 0 14360 Mantech International Corp. CL A 564563104 1027 35405 SH SOLE 33030 0 2375 Marinemax Inc. COM 567908108 959 40800 SH SOLE 39885 0 915 Mastercard Inc Cl A CL A 57636Q104 1444 15450 SH SOLE 15450 0 0 Mastercard Inc Cl A CL A 57636Q104 93 1000 SH OTR 1000 0 0 Matrix Service Company COM 576853105 2036 111390 SH SOLE 108890 0 2500 Mc Dermott International Inc COM 580037109 14172 2653854 SH SOLE 2506014 0 147840 Media General Inc New COM 58441K100 239 14489 SH SOLE 14489 0 0 Medical Properties Trust Inc. COM 58463J304 305 23275 SH SOLE 23275 0 0 Medical Properties Trust Inc. COM 58463J304 39 3000 SH OTR 3000 0 0 Microchip Technology COM 595017104 3185 67160 SH SOLE 64490 0 2670 Microchip Technology COM 595017104 66 1400 SH OTR 1400 0 0 Microsoft Corp. COM 594918104 3504 79369 SH SOLE 54685 0 24684 Mondelez International Inc. CL A 609207105 477 11584 SH SOLE 8692 0 2892 Montpelier RE Holdings, Ltd. SHS g62185106 8067 204236 SH SOLE 190925 0 13311 Murphy Oil Corp. COM 626717102 888 21367 SH SOLE 21017 0 350 Newmarket Corp. COM 651587107 648 1460 SH SOLE 1460 0 0 Noble Energy, Inc COM 655044105 256 6000 SH SOLE 6000 0 0 Noodles & Company CL A 65540B105 1242 85060 SH SOLE 83170 0 1890 Norfolk Southern Corp. COM 655844108 2719 31124 SH SOLE 20799 0 10325 Oasis Petroleum Inc. COM 674215108 943 59500 SH SOLE 49500 0 10000 Outerwall Inc. COM 690070107 1216 15980 SH SOLE 15630 0 350 Paychex, Inc. COM 704326107 200 4275 SH SOLE 4275 0 0 Pepsico, Inc. COM 713448108 3095 33161 SH SOLE 23324 0 9837 Pepsico, Inc. COM 713448108 56 600 SH OTR 600 0 0 Perkin Elmer COM 714046109 1626 30895 SH SOLE 30895 0 0 Pfizer Inc. COM 717081103 2285 68150 SH SOLE 50442 0 17708 Philip Morris International, I COM 718172109 1022 12744 SH SOLE 11444 0 1300 Piedmont Nat Gas Inc. COM 720186105 318 9000 SH SOLE 4700 0 4300 Pier 1 Imports Inc. COM 720279108 4087 323595 SH SOLE 303255 0 20340 Ply Gem Holdings Inc. COM 72941W100 1919 162725 SH SOLE 159124 0 3601 Procter & Gamble Co. COM 742718109 4024 51434 SH SOLE 40627 0 10807 Quidel Corp. COM 74838J101 6801 296341 SH SOLE 275946 0 20395 RPM, Inc. COM 749685103 349 7130 SH SOLE 6190 0 940 Rayonier Advanced Materials In COM 75508B104 1713 105360 SH SOLE 98670 0 6690 Royal Bank of Canada COM 780087102 772 12630 SH SOLE 9462 0 3168 Royal Dutch Shell PLC Class A SPONS ADR A 780259206 2150 37719 SH SOLE 28844 0 8875 SAP Aktiengesellschaft Sponsor SPON ADR 803054204 1221 17389 SH SOLE 17389 0 0 SAP Aktiengesellschaft Sponsor SPON ADR 803054204 28 400 SH OTR 400 0 0 Sanchez Energy Corp. COM 79970Y105 1138 116100 SH SOLE 116100 0 0 Schlumberger Limited COM 806857108 5079 58929 SH SOLE 51008 0 7921 Schlumberger Limited COM 806857108 55 633 SH OTR 633 0 0 Snap On Inc. COM 833034101 1734 10890 SH SOLE 10890 0 0 Southern Co. COM 842587107 329 7850 SH SOLE 4000 0 3850 Southwestern Energy Company COM 845467109 3630 159700 SH SOLE 150800 0 8900 Stamps.com Inc. COM 852857200 1305 17736 SH SOLE 17331 0 405 Starbucks Corp. COM 855244109 1703 31763 SH SOLE 31763 0 0 Stone Energy COM 861642106 2947 234045 SH SOLE 226711 0 7334 Stratasys, Ltd. SHS M85548101 1070 30640 SH SOLE 29960 0 680 Superior Energy Services COM 868157108 709 33700 SH SOLE 33700 0 0 T. Rowe Price Group Inc. COM 74144T108 6312 81203 SH SOLE 76508 0 4695 Target Corp. COM 87612e106 2704 33120 SH SOLE 31030 0 2090 Thermo Fisher Scientific COM 883556102 2268 17477 SH SOLE 12200 0 5277 Total SA SPONSORED ADR 89151E109 2703 54974 SH SOLE 46187 0 8787 Trimas Corporation COM NEW 896215209 1113 47192 SH SOLE 46153 0 1039 Tyson Foods Inc. CL A 902494103 1522 35695 SH SOLE 35695 0 0 U.S. Bancorp COM NEW 902973304 1822 41993 SH SOLE 31212 0 10781 UDR Inc. COM 902653104 306 9550 SH SOLE 7168 0 2382 UTI Worldwide Inc. ORD G87210103 1563 156415 SH SOLE 152965 0 3450 Union Bankshares Corporation COM 90539J109 1268 54544 SH SOLE 53344 0 1200 Union Pacific Corp. COM 907818108 1063 11145 SH SOLE 11145 0 0 Union Pacific Corp. COM 907818108 19 196 SH OTR 196 0 0 United Parcel Service, Inc. CL B 911312106 2881 29727 SH SOLE 28322 0 1405 United Technologies Corp. COM 913017109 2794 25184 SH SOLE 18509 0 6675 Valspar Corp COM 920355104 764 9336 SH SOLE 9336 0 0 Verizon Communications COM 92343v104 447 9599 SH SOLE 4770 0 4829 Visa Inc. COM 92826C839 1991 29657 SH SOLE 22002 0 7655 WEC Energy Group Inc. COM 92939U106 1144 25435 SH SOLE 23685 0 1750 Wal-Mart Stores COM 931142103 1575 22210 SH SOLE 19645 0 2565 Wal-Mart Stores COM 931142103 43 600 SH OTR 600 0 0 Walgreens Boots Alliance, Inc. COM 931427108 2133 25265 SH SOLE 17915 0 7350 Waters Corp. COM 941848103 1472 11467 SH SOLE 11467 0 0 Wells Fargo & Co. COM 949746101 5430 96547 SH SOLE 80380 0 16167 Wells Fargo & Co. COM 949746101 79 1400 SH OTR 1400 0 0 White Mountains Group Bermuda COM G9618E107 546 834 SH SOLE 784 0 50